There are only 2 west coast D3 conferences, NWC and SCIAC which is sad for playoff travel because they almost have to face off in the 1st round regardless of ranking.

The NWC easily tops the SCIAC as the superior conference.  The drop from 1 to 4 in the NWC is far less steep than the SCIAC.  The best IIAC teams I've seen over the years would be competitive with Linfield - however the past couple of years (2010, 2011) just seems to me that the IIAC has dropped a notch  if not more - to the extent I do not think the IIAC has a team that would in fact be competitive with today's Linfield.

I've attended a good many SCIAC games over the last few years - even their best teams have not particularly impressed me and the drop from today's Cal Lu to the next team (my hometown Bulldogs) is kind of sad.  It will be interesting to see if Cal Lu can keep it going over the long haul too and until they beat Linfield, they have not proven the are in that class.

A couple of weeks ago my old college roommate who is a DC at one of the SCIAC schools (not Cal Lu or UofR) offered us tickets, so I took him up on the offer and took Heys Jr. and Rev. 3 to the game.

These teams were not good.  They shall remain nameless out of respect to my buddy and to parents of kids that I know on both sides of the ball.

Jr. wished he got the chance to play against the types of players we saw out there (smaller, slower).  In his time at Cornell he faced some pretty good Central, Wartburg, and Coe teams.  Luther was competitive and Dubuque was on the upswing.  Loras, Simpson and BV easily compared favorably over CMS, P-P, Whittier, and La Verne.

Rev. 3 was a bit shocked and unimpressed at the relative level of play (not as good as he remembers watching when we went Jr's. games)

What's this all mean...I dunno...but it's an easy call that the NWC is better than the IIAC which is better than the SCIAC, looking top to bottom.

Yeah, that '01 PLU was a couple of notches down from the '99 Lutes and/or the more recent Linfield teams.  Just to clarify, PLU was awarded a Pool B bid in '01 and was not chosen 'over' Wartburg - you'd have to look up the last team or two that got a Pool C bid that year.  The NWC didn't have an automatic bid until '08, and Pool B teams were not allowed to earn a Pool C 'runner-up/at large' bid until very recently.  But yes, the NWC got two Pool B bids a few times.
